A default finders fee is configured in CollectionOffersV1's constructor:

Since the maximum finders fee is 10000, a 100 bps finders fee is 1%, not 10%.

It follows that 0.95 ETH * 1% is 0.0095 ETH as it's expressed in the assertion.

Given this context, the following annotation should be updated accordingly for correctness:
